On Fri, Aug 17, 2012 at 06:25:56PM +0100, Stefano Stabellini wrote:
> On Thu, 16 Aug 2012, Konrad Rzeszutek Wilk wrote:
> > With this patch we provide the functionality to initialize the
> > Xen-SWIOTLB late in the bootup cycle - specifically for
> > Xen PCI-frontend. We still will work if the user had
> > supplied 'iommu=soft' on the Linux command line.

>From d815253cbf26a5273e77f829cc414e0808500263 Mon Sep 17 00:00:00 2001
From: Konrad Rzeszutek Wilk <konrad.wilk@...cle.com>
Date: Thu, 23 Aug 2012 14:36:15 -0400
Subject: [PATCH 3/3] xen/swiotlb: Use the swiotlb_late_init_with_tbl to init
 Xen-SWIOTLB late when PV PCI is used.

With this patch we provide the functionality to initialize the
Xen-SWIOTLB late in the bootup cycle - specifically for
Xen PCI-frontend. We still will work if the user had
supplied 'iommu=soft' on the Linux command line.

CC: FUJITA Tomonori <fujita.tomonori@....ntt.co.jp>
[v1: Fix smatch warnings]
[v2: Added check for xen_swiotlb]
[v3: Rebased with new xen-swiotlb changes]
Signed-off-by: Konrad Rzeszutek Wilk <konrad.wilk@...cle.com>
